How big is the Smart Cards and Access Control market in UK?

The UK smart card and access control system market, estimated at £750 million (2023), is experiencing steady growth driven by increasing security demands, technological advancements, and government initiatives. This market is expected to grow at a CAGR of 3% due to rising demand for integrated security solutions and contactless technologies.

What Smart Cards and Access Control does the UK government buy?

Key Products and Services Sought by the Government
Smart Cards: Secure cards containing electronic chips for identification, authentication, and access control within government buildings and systems.
Biometric Access Control Systems: Fingerprint scanners, iris scanners, and other technologies for verifying identity and granting access based on individual biometrics.
Integrated Security Management Systems: Software platforms for managing access control, video surveillance, intrusion detection, and other security systems.
Cloud-based Access Control Solutions: Remote management and monitoring of access control systems through secure cloud platforms.

Major Smart Cards and Access Control buyers in UK government

Top Authorities Guiding Procurement
Crown Commercial Service (CCS): Central government procurement agency responsible for managing contracts for a range of goods and services, including smart cards and access control systems.
Government Digital Service (GDS): Sets standards and promotes digital transformation across government, influencing the adoption of modern access control solutions.
Ministry of Justice (MoJ): Oversees security for courts and prisons, influencing the procurement of high-security access control systems.
Department for Digital, Culture, Media & Sport (DCMS): Supports the development of the digital economy and promotes cyber security, influencing the adoption of innovative access control solutions.

Who wins the most Smart Cards and Access Control contracts from the UK government?

Top Winners of Government Contracts
HID Global: Leading provider of secure identity solutions, securing contracts for smart cards and access control systems.
Gemalto (Thales Group): Global leader in digital security, winning contracts for government smart cards and integrated security management systems.
Assa Abloy: Major provider of door and access control solutions, supplying systems to government buildings and facilities.
Nedap Identification Systems: Leading provider of RFID-based access control solutions, securing contracts for government buildings and sensitive sites.
